Paul Casey displayed good golf at his first round at the Barclay Classic to put him on the map for a captains pick alongside Colin Montgomerie and Ian Poulter. Meanwhile, at the KLM Open Justin Rose, Oliver Wilson and of course Martin Kaymer try to pick up points for their automatic spot on the team. Darren Clarke hopes are focused on a wildcard.
After round one in Kennemer, Justin Rose put himself in a good position at -3, Oliver Wilson is at -1. Martin Kaymer gave himself a lot of work to do for todays round, at +2 he’s got to work his way into the cut. His direct rival for a Ryder Cup spot is Soren Hansen and he is seven shots ahead of Martin at -5 in T2. We keep our fingers crossed.
